Kinds Of Liposuction Techniques



When thinking about liposuction surgery, it's vital to understand that there are numerous strategies readily available, each tailored to meet various demands and choices. Traditional liposuction uses a cannula to suction fat from targeted locations through tiny cuts. Tumescent lipo entails infusing a service to numb the area and minimize blood loss.


Laser-assisted lipo, or SmartLipo, makes use of laser energy to melt fat prior to elimination, making it less intrusive and advertising skin tightening (Liposuction Surgeon Austin TX). Ultrasound-assisted liposuction uses ultrasound waves to break down fat cells, making them less complicated to draw out


For a gentler method, power-assisted liposuction makes use of a vibrating cannula, reducing the effort needed for fat elimination. Each approach has its advantages and potential downsides, so it's necessary to review these alternatives with your surgeon. Potential Dangers and Issues



Although lipo therapy is usually secure, it's vital to be conscious of prospective risks and problems that can occur. There's also the threat of too much blood loss, leading to hematomas or even requiring added procedures.


In rare cases, you might come across more significant problems like blood embolisms or adverse responses to anesthetic. Nerve damages is one more possibility, causing momentary or permanent tingling in the cured location. Furthermore, you might take care of fluid buildup, requiring drainage.


It's essential to have an honest conversation with your cosmetic surgeon about these risks and assure you're educated. By comprehending these possible problems, you can make an extra enlightened decision about whether lipo therapy is right for you.

Activity Restrictions Duration



While you're recuperating from lipo treatment, it's crucial to understand the task limitations you'll deal with. Commonly, you should avoid exhausting activities for a minimum of two weeks post-procedure. This includes hefty lifting, intense exercises, and any high-impact workouts. Light walking is urged to promote blood flow, yet pay attention to your body. After the preliminary two weeks, you can progressively reintroduce modest activities, yet always talk to your cosmetic surgeon for personalized advice. Full recovery might take numerous weeks, and it is very important to focus on remainder throughout this duration. Take note of your body's signals, and do not hurry back right into your regular routine. Complying with these restrictions will certainly aid guarantee a smoother recuperation and far better results from your lipo treatment.

Price Factors To Consider and Budgeting for Lipo





Lipo treatment can substantially vary in price, making it vital to comprehend what influences pricing prior to choosing. Numerous elements come right into play, including the kind of lipo procedure, the doctor's experience, and your geographical location. Generally, you can anticipate expenses to range from $2,000 to $7,000 per session.


Do not fail to remember to account for added costs, such as anesthetic, facility costs, and post-operative care. It's important to speak with several centers to compare solutions and prices. Some facilities offer financing alternatives or settlement plans, which can assist spread out the expense gradually.


Before committing, validate you're clear on what's consisted of in the estimated cost. Bear in mind, the most affordable alternative isn't always the ideal; prioritize top quality and safety and security over financial savings.
